According to the Telegraph:
"Mike Ashley is ready to intervene and will urge managing director Lee Charnley to sack the head coach this weekend after a terrible eight-month reign."Moyes, who was sacked as Real Sociedad manager last November, is reportedly interested in the job, but there are still some issues to iron out.
"There are potential stumbling blocks to remove in negotiations, but the job does appeal to the former Manchester United manager. "Moyes knows he would be taking a risk accepting the Newcastle job given their troubles under Ashley and he would will want reassurances about player recruitment."
